## Summary

The video discusses the current state of AI agents, backlinks, and SEO, highlighting the importance of backlinks in the era of AI-generated content. The presenter showcases Chinese AI models like GLM 5.2, Kimi K2.7, and N2, and demonstrates how to use them within an agent operating system to build various applications.

### Key Points

- **Backlinks remain crucial** [09:04] — Despite AI making content creation easy, backlinks are more important than ever as a differentiator. Building backlinks cannot be fully automated yet.
- **AI agent for backlink outreach** [13:21] — An AI agent can handle backlink outreach by targeting small, realistic websites. The presenter's system sets up full outreach campaigns automatically.
- **Three Chinese AI models introduced** [41:13] — GLM 5.2, Kimi K2.7, and N2 are powerful Chinese AI models. N2 is temporarily free as an API, Kimi K2.7 will be open source, and GLM 5.2 is currently the best of the three.
- **Kimi K2.7 capabilities** [42:10] — Kimi K2.7 can code quickly, create videos, and build games. It has a 'fast mode' and can create content that rivals human quality.
- **Judge agent for quality control** [46:35] — Using a judge agent within the agent OS allows the system to critique its own work and iterate until completion, ensuring quality control.
- **Agent OS as key differentiator** [50:22] — An operating system for agents is essential to organize and maximize the potential of multiple AI models. Without it, users cannot easily coordinate or track outputs.
- **Fusion method outperforms benchmarks** [52:10] — Using a panel of agents with a fusion API from OpenRouter, a judge fuses answers to produce better results than single models like Claude, as shown on the Draco score.

### Conclusion

The presenter emphasizes that organizing AI agents within an operating system unlocks their full potential, and Chinese models like GLM 5.2 are now competitive with or superior to Claude for coding tasks.
